简介:1968年,曼联以一座沉甸甸的欧洲冠军杯,祭奠了在慕尼黑空难中丧生的"巴斯比孩子"的亡灵;31年之后,曼联再现昔日荣光,弗格森率领着空前强大的"红魔",开辟了史无前例的黄金时代。1999年,曼联囊括了英超冠军、足总杯冠军和欧洲冠军联赛冠军,风头一时无两,尤其是在冠军联赛决赛中上演的神奇大逆转,更是史无前例。接下来的两个赛季,曼联以绝对优势连续夺取英超冠军,他们也成为了首支完成英超三连霸的王者之师。从单赛季的三冠王到三夺英超锦标,十年磨一剑的弗格森迎来了教练生涯最华彩的三年,贝克汉姆领衔的"92一代"、狂傲不羁的基恩以及珠联璧合的"黑风双煞"威震四方。曼联的辉煌永远不会随着光阴的流逝而褪色,那些血与火的场景、跋涉和征服的脚印、夺冠时刻的纵情欢呼,至今仍停驻在无数球迷的脑海。

简介:1998款丰田佳美轿车防抱死制动(ABS)系统和牵引力控制(TRAC)系统主要由ABS/TRAC电子控制单元(ECU)、执行器、电磁阀继电器、电机继电器、TRACOFF(牵引力控制取消)开关和速度传感器等组成.
